Custom Bay Window Installation: Enhancing Your Home's Aesthetic and Value

Bay windows have long been a popular architectural feature in homes, adding charm, character, and an abundance of natural light to interior areas. A properly designed bay window not only enhances the visual appeal of a residential or commercial property however also enhances functionality by offering extra seating or storage area. In this short article, readers will discover the advantages of custom bay window installation, the different design choices available, and a step-by-step guide on how to approach the installation process.

What is a Bay Window?

A bay window normally consists of three or more sections that protrude from the main wall of a building. The main sector is frequently larger than the side ones, producing an inviting nook that supplies a view of the outdoors while adding depth to the space. There are different kinds of bay windows, consisting of:

  1. Canted Bay Windows: These are angled at 30 or 45 degrees and are the most typical design.

  2. Box Bay Windows: Featuring a square shape, these offer an extensive view and can provide more interior space.

  3. Oriel Bay Windows: Projecting from the upper levels of a structure, oriel windows are frequently decorative and without support at ground level.

  4. Circle Bay Windows: Consisting of a curved design, these include an unique style to the home's exterior.

Advantages of Custom Bay Window Installation

Deciding for a custom bay window installation includes many advantages. Below are some benefits that property owners can anticipate:

  • Increased Natural Light: Bay windows permit more sunlight into the home, minimizing the requirement for artificial lighting.

  • Improved Aesthetics: Customization choices allow house owners to pick designs that match their home's special design.

  • Enhanced Ventilation: With operable side windows, bay windows can increase air flow and improve cross-ventilation.

  • Increased Property Value: An aesthetically pleasing bay window can contribute to higher resale values as they are extremely searched for functions in property.

  • Multipurpose Use: Beyond being aesthetically attractive, bay windows can be used as seating locations, plant display screens, or storage alternatives.

Design Options for Custom Bay Windows

When considering a custom bay window installation, homeowners have a large variety of design options to choose from. Here's a breakdown:

Materials

  1. Vinyl: Low-maintenance and energy-efficient, vinyl windows are flexible and can be found in a range of styles and colors.

  2. Wood: Offering natural beauty and aesthetic heat, wood windows can be painted or stained but need more maintenance.

  3. Aluminum: Durable and light-weight, aluminum windows are perfect for modern homes but may not supply as much insulation.

Styles

  • Standard: Clean lines and traditional surfaces that fit older homes or period architecture.
  • Modern: Sleek, minimalist designs with big panes of glass that complement modern styles.
  • Victorian: Ornate details such as trim and mullions that reflect a more intricate architectural design.

Additional Features

  • Energy-Efficient Glazing: Triple or double glazing can significantly boost thermal performance.
  • Decorative Grilles: These can add character to the window while increasing aesthetic appeal.
  • Retractable Screens: Ideal for airflow without jeopardizing the view.

Step-by-Step Guide to Custom Bay Window Installation

Setting up a custom bay window requires comprehensive preparation and execution. Here's an in-depth procedure to follow:

Step 1: Research and Planning

  • Identify the wanted location and dimensions.
  • Pick materials and designs.
  • Get necessary permits from local structure authorities.

Action 2: Measuring the Area

  • Procedure the opening where the bay window will be set up carefully.
  • Verify that the measurements are precise; dimensions must permit for structural assistance.

Action 3: Removing the Old Window (if applicable)

  • Carefully get rid of the existing window structure.
  • Make sure assistance for any above structures is undamaged throughout removal.

Step 4: Preparing the Frame

  • Develop the supporting frame to hold the bay window.
  • Ensure it meets local building codes and is square and level.

Step 5: Installing the Bay Window

  • Position the bay window in the prepared frame.
  • Protect it in location and guarantee it is level.
  • Install any needed assistances.

Action 6: Finishing Touches

  • Insulate around the window frame to boost energy effectiveness.
  • Seal all joints with caulking.
  • Finish the interior trim and paint to match the home's décor.

Maintenance Tips for Bay Windows

To guarantee longevity and ideal efficiency, preserving your bay windows is essential:

  • Regular Cleaning: Use a moderate cleaning agent and water for cleaning up the glass and frame.
  • Check Seals and Caulking: Inspect seals annually and replace any worn-out caulking to avoid drafts.
  • Monitor for Damage: Regularly look for indications of wood rot, breaking, or warping and address them instantly.

Frequently asked questions

Q1: How much does a custom bay window installation cost?

A1: The cost can vary significantly based on size, products, and labor, ranging from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 7,500 or more.

Q2: Can I install a bay window myself?

A2: While DIY installation is possible, it requires woodworking abilities. It is advisable to hire specialists for best results.

Q3: What are the best products for energy efficiency?

A3: Wood and vinyl tend to provide better insulation compared to aluminum. Look for double or triple glazing also.

Q4: How long does a bay window installation take?

A4: On average, a professional installation can take anywhere from one to three days, depending upon complexity.

Q5: Are bay windows suitable for all climates?

A5: Yes, but factors to consider such as insulation, product options, and sealing are important for efficiency in severe environments.

Custom bay window installation not just boosts the exterior appeal of a home but likewise increases its interior performance and natural light. With various design options and materials available, house owners can create a bay window that deals with their aesthetic choices and useful needs. Following the installation actions and employing regular upkeep will guarantee that the bay window stays a valued feature of the home for many years to come.
